Output 17ea0d90e48bd8921d03474cf5545a1dbe2215aa26d9ba69fd563eecbc5c15c8:0

value
623140515
script pubkey
OP_0 OP_PUSHBYTES_20 18bd58a01f5ab8d51053c0e3e104185574de6d90
address
tb1qrz743gqlt2ud2yzncr37zpqc246dumvs9jfz37
transaction
17ea0d90e48bd8921d03474cf5545a1dbe2215aa26d9ba69fd563eecbc5c15c8